What is Membership Management Software?

Membership management software such Springly serves as a centralized platform that helps organizations track, engage, and manage their members efficiently. Instead of juggling multiple tools and spreadsheets, organizations can consolidate essential functions like member registration, payment processing, communication, and event management into a single, cohesive system. These platforms have evolved significantly over the years, moving from simple database systems to sophisticated solutions that can handle complex member relationships and interactions.

Key Features of a Membership Management Software

Modern membership platforms excel at streamlining database management through sophisticated contact tracking and automated renewal processes. Financial operations become seamless with integrated payment processing and automated invoicing systems that reduce manual intervention. Organizations can maintain consistent communication through targeted email campaigns and newsletter distribution, while members benefit from self-service portals that provide instant access to resources and information.

Advanced features often include customizable membership levels, automated welcome sequences, and engagement scoring systems. These tools help organizations create personalized experiences for different member segments while maintaining efficient operations at scale.

Benefits for Organizations

Organizations implementing membership software experience significant improvements in operational efficiency by automating routine administrative tasks. This automation allows staff to focus more on strategic initiatives and member engagement rather than paperwork. The member experience improves through streamlined registration processes and convenient payment options, leading to higher satisfaction and retention rates.

Data-driven decision making becomes possible as organizations gain insight into membership trends, engagement levels, and revenue patterns. This information helps in developing targeted programs and services that better serve member needs. Additionally, the software’s reporting capabilities enable organizations to demonstrate value to stakeholders and make informed strategic decisions about member programs and services.

Implementation Considerations

When implementing membership software, organizations must prioritize security through robust data encryption and privacy compliance measures. The software should seamlessly integrate with existing systems, including CRM platforms, accounting software, and email services. Organizations should evaluate potential solutions based on their specific size, budget constraints, technical requirements, and scalability needs.

The implementation process typically involves several phases, from initial data migration to staff training and system optimization. Organizations should plan for adequate training time and consider change management strategies to ensure successful adoption across their team.

Cost Factors

The cost of membership management software typically varies based on several factors. Organizations should consider the number of members they serve, their required features, implementation needs, and desired level of support when budgeting for these solutions. While initial costs may seem significant, the long-term benefits often justify the investment through improved efficiency and member satisfaction.

Many providers offer tiered pricing models that allow organizations to start with basic features and upgrade as their needs grow. Additional costs might include data migration, training, and customization services, which should be factored into the total budget.

Future Trends in Membership Management

The membership management landscape continues to evolve with emerging technologies. Artificial intelligence and machine learning are beginning to play larger roles in predicting member behavior and personalizing experiences. Mobile accessibility has become increasingly important, with more platforms offering comprehensive mobile apps for both administrators and members.

Integration capabilities are expanding, allowing organizations to create more connected digital ecosystems. This includes integration with virtual event platforms, learning management systems, and advanced analytics tools, providing more comprehensive solutions for modern membership organizations.

Making the Right Choice for Your Organization

Selecting the right membership management software requires careful evaluation of your organization’s specific needs and goals. Consider starting with a detailed assessment of your current processes and pain points. This will help identify must-have features versus nice-to-have capabilities. Involve key stakeholders in the selection process and take advantage of free trials or demos when available.

Remember that the best solution isn’t necessarily the one with the most features, but rather the one that best aligns with your organization’s workflow and objectives. Look for providers who offer strong support services and regular platform updates to ensure long-term success with your chosen solution.
